Where is Crypto.com's simulated trading function? Is it charged?
Crypto.com doesn't offer simulated trading, but provides learning resources like Crypto.com University and Trading Academy to help users understand the crypto market.
May 10, 2025 at 10:01 pm

Crypto.com, one of the leading platforms in the cryptocurrency industry, offers a variety of tools and features to help users engage with the crypto market. One of the features that many traders look for is a simulated trading function, also known as a demo account or paper trading. This article will explore where to find Crypto.com's simulated trading function and whether it incurs any charges.
What is Simulated Trading?
Simulated trading is a feature that allows users to practice trading cryptocurrencies without risking real money. It's an excellent tool for beginners to familiarize themselves with the platform and for experienced traders to test new strategies. Simulated trading on Crypto.com enables users to experience the platform's interface, trading mechanics, and market conditions without financial risk.
Availability of Simulated Trading on Crypto.com
As of the latest updates, Crypto.com does not offer a built-in simulated trading function directly within its platform. This means that users cannot access a demo account or paper trading feature through the main Crypto.com app or website. However, Crypto.com does provide other tools and resources that can help users learn about trading and the crypto market.
Alternative Tools for Learning and Practicing
While Crypto.com itself does not have a simulated trading function, there are alternative ways for users to practice trading and learn about the market:
Crypto.com University: This is an educational platform provided by Crypto.com, offering courses and resources on various aspects of cryptocurrencies and trading. Users can learn about market analysis, trading strategies, and more.
External Simulated Trading Platforms: There are third-party platforms and apps that offer simulated trading for cryptocurrencies. Users can practice trading on these platforms, which often include a variety of cryptocurrencies, including those listed on Crypto.com.
Crypto.com's Trading Academy: This feature within the Crypto.com app provides tutorials and guides on how to trade on the platform. While it does not offer simulated trading, it helps users understand the trading process and the platform's features.
Is There a Charge for Simulated Trading on Crypto.com?
Since Crypto.com does not offer a built-in simulated trading function, there is no charge for using such a feature directly on their platform. However, if users opt to use external simulated trading platforms, they should check whether those platforms have any fees or subscription costs.
How to Access Crypto.com University and Trading Academy
To make the most out of the learning resources provided by Crypto.com, follow these steps:
Access Crypto.com University:
- Visit the Crypto.com website.
- Navigate to the "Learn" section.
- Click on "Crypto.com University" to access courses and resources.
Access Crypto.com's Trading Academy:
- Open the Crypto.com app on your mobile device.
- Navigate to the "Learn" tab within the app.
- Select "Trading Academy" to view tutorials and guides on trading.
Benefits of Using Simulated Trading
Even though Crypto.com does not offer a direct simulated trading function, understanding the benefits of such a feature can help users appreciate the value of practice and learning:
Risk-Free Learning: Simulated trading allows users to learn without the fear of losing real money, making it an ideal starting point for beginners.
Strategy Testing: Experienced traders can use simulated trading to test new strategies and see how they perform in different market conditions.
Platform Familiarization: Users can become more comfortable with the trading platform's interface and features, which can improve their real trading experience.
Market Understanding: By practicing trading, users can gain a better understanding of market trends, volatility, and other factors that affect cryptocurrency prices.
Conclusion
While Crypto.com does not currently offer a simulated trading function within its platform, it provides valuable resources like Crypto.com University and the Trading Academy to help users learn about trading and the crypto market. Users interested in simulated trading can explore external platforms that offer this feature, keeping in mind any potential fees associated with those services.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I use Crypto.com's mobile app to access simulated trading?
A: No, Crypto.com's mobile app does not currently offer a simulated trading function. However, you can access educational resources through the app's Trading Academy.
Q: Are there any plans for Crypto.com to introduce a simulated trading feature in the future?
A: Crypto.com has not made any public announcements regarding the introduction of a simulated trading feature. Users should keep an eye on official updates from Crypto.com for any future developments.
Q: What are the best external platforms for simulated trading in cryptocurrencies?
A: Some popular external platforms for simulated trading include TradingView, eToro, and Binance Futures. Each platform offers different features and cryptocurrencies, so users should choose one that best fits their needs.
Q: Can I practice trading on Crypto.com's desktop version?
A: No, the desktop version of Crypto.com also does not offer a simulated trading function. However, you can access Crypto.com University through the website to learn about trading and the crypto market.
